Candidate Statement
As a community advocate and Assemblywoman, I have never hesitated to fight injustice wherever it may be. I am most proud of the NYS Assembly passing my bail reform bill, which will move our state toward a more intelligent, individualized system of pre-trial release, monitoring and, when necessary, detention. The bill will end the current monetary bail system, which has resulted in excessive pre-trial jailing of thousands of New Yorkers. I will work with Mayor de Blasio, or any elected official if the intention is to help the people of New York City. However, I will never hesitate to stand up to the Mayor and take him on whenever he neglects the needs of any community, or wherever I see the inhumane treatment of any group of New Yorkers.
Reprinted as supplied by the candidate 2019.
